At Sāvatthī. “Mendicants, one who does not truly know or see old age and death should seek the Teacher so as to truly know old age and death. One who does not truly know or see the origin of old age and death should seek the Teacher so as to truly know the origin of old age and death. One who does not truly know or see the cessation of old age and death should seek the Teacher so as to truly know the cessation of old age and death.
